For a beginner, how long and how often should i work out?

start off with a full body workout about 3x per week for about 2 months so your body gets used to the weights.

full body workouts utilize compound exercises to build muscle, as compound exercises build the most mass.

I would start off doing these every workout:

squats (4x10 one set warmup)
deadlifts (4x10 one set warmup)
bench press (4x10 one set warmup)
pullups (3 sets until failure)
upright rows (3x10)
bent over barbell rows (3x10)

if you don't know how to do the exercise, just Google search the name or go to the website www.shapefit.com and locate the exercise guide.

most people do fullbody workouts on monday, wednesday, friday and these workouts last about 45min - 1hr.

you'll hit every major muscle group with this workout.

once you become more experienced and advanced you can split to an intermediate workout like 4 day split working 2 bodyparts a day etc.

diet-wise, just consume enough protein. if you weigh 150lbs, get in at least 150g of protein per day. basically, at least 1 gram per lb of bodyweight. eat chicken, beef, tuna, turkey, eggs, nuts and whole grain food like bread & pasta.

a whey protein shake wouldn't hurt either, i personally take one in the morning and another shake 30 min after workout.
